Slim doesn't works but LXDE is ok

Hello (and sorry for my english tongue)

I installed today arch linux on my laptop. At the beginning, everything was ok, slim  worked fine. After playing with the policykit issue (see "I won the struggle against hal and policykit": http://bbs.archlinux.org/viewtopic.php?id=65070 )and installing the networkmanager (both are working now), slim doesn't works any more - I get a black screen with no mouse and nothing. I think that the problem is slim itself, because if I tipe "startx" from the commandline as normal user (after having killed X as root) lxde starts and everything works. I tried to reinstall slim but it doesn't works.
I don't know which files to post, so here are two of them hmm

[swisstux@inspiron ~]$ cat .xinitrc 
exec ck-launch-session startlxde
[swisstux@inspiron ~]$ cat /etc/rc.conf 
...
DAEMONS=(syslog-ng polkitparser hal @cpufreq @laptop-mode @networkmanager @crond @alsa @slim)
...

Re: Slim doesn't works but LXDE is ok

it says only this:
slim: Stale lockfile found, removing it

it is a bit slow (too slow, on another PC it is 10 times faster), but it works if I start it from the command line. just on boot it doesn't works.


edit: here is the log of slim starting at boot and at the end the log of slim starting from the shell: http://pastebin.com/m4b6fad81
second edit: I removed every "@" from the daemon's list in rc.conf and now it works. but it is still really slow
